U.S. Treasury Awards $118 Million
AI Workforce Agreement.

Through a $118 million IRS OCIO workforce development award, Codesmith helps Treasury and IRS teams build AI-ready engineering capability.

Agreement Overview

Codesmith helps Treasury and IRS teams build the engineering capability needed to modernize mission-critical systems and serve the American public.

The engagement supports developer organization development: stronger structure, clearer operating practices, and scale.

Implementation Journey:

Award

IRS OCIO selected Codesmith under the Technical Workforce Development and Training BPA.

Align

Training priorities map to Treasury and IRS teams maintaining mission-critical public systems.

Build

Programs focus on advanced software engineering, AI-supported workflows, and practical execution.

Enable

Civil service teams develop the internal capability to safely evolve legacy systems.

Sustain

The engagement supports engineering culture and technical progress designed to last for decades.
